Beating the Sicilian: Grandmaster Bologan's Repertoire Vol.3
In the third volume of the Open Sicilian, Black's second move 2...e6 is addressed, which he normally adopts when he is looking for a complex game, full of subtleties with which to overcome White, especially when his opponent has lower score. But the other side of the coin is that Black takes quite high risks and with a rigorous reaction White can get them into serious trouble. Of course the DVD is mainly dedicated to all kinds of variants of the Paulsen with 4… a6 and 4… Nc6, in which against most of the main variants the author advises the same configuration used against the Najdorf and the Dragon with Be3 , f3 and Qd2, usually followed by long castling. Despite the many games played every day, White is still far from being able to equalize with certainty. Apart from some minor variants like 5…Bb4, it is quite important to learn how to play the classic Keres Attack. After 6.g4, my recommendation, only the variation with 6…e5 still poses unpleasant questions to White, to which, of course, I have tried to provide some answers. With the last installment of the Sicilian trilogy, I would encourage the viewer to play the Open Sicilian and to have the DVDs as partners, reference material and friends in both critical and good situations.
